Abstract:
Angled grating DFB lasers with long resonators were fabricated and characterised at 1060 nm. 4 mm-long laser diodes showed a CW-output power of 3 W with a times-diffraction-limit factor M2 = 3.2 and a spectral line width of 6 pm. A high spectral brightness of better than 1.2 x 104 MW/(cm2sr nm) results.
